Kaiser’s Forces Resume Offensive In Europe War Report

London dispatches describe a furious night assault near Visay where German troops stormed Allied trenches and were repelled, gaining 900 yards. British infantry fought mud and bayonets to recapture trenches, with German losses reported at 260 killed and wounded and 117 prisoners. Amsterdam and other sources note heavy fighting near Lens and Arras, and assaults on Soissons and the Argonne with limited German gains. Separate reports from Constantinople and Petrograd cover Turkish denial of Erezerum retreat and a savage battle along a forty mile Russian front near the German border.

Queen Helena to Adopt Earthquake Orphans in Rome

In Rome, Queen Helena ordered photographs of earthquake survivors to aid identification and plans to adopt all unidentified children. About 550 nameless orphans were cared for at the Quirinal and sheltered in asylums and convents while others were treated at the Queen's hospital. The quake damaged Avezzano and nearby towns injuring residents, and the Orvieto Cathedral sustained facade damage amid Italy's seismic aftermath.

Senate Debates German Ship Purchases as Neutrality Threats

In Washington on January 22 Senator Lodge warned that buying German ships laid up in Boston and New York would edge the US toward war with multiple powers. He argued such purchases would aid a belligerent, breach neutrality, and suggested amendments to bar government acquisitions. He cited McAdoo hearings and possible plans to transfer a German-owned Daela to American buyers.

Burlington to spend million on Guernsey cutoff railroad

Burlington announces immediate construction of the Guernsey cutoff from Wendover Junction to Guernsey at a cost near 1 million dollars. The project includes tunnels and heavy building to create a low grade link across the West, linking Billings Montana to Paducah Kentucky with a major basin route in Wyoming Colorado and Nebraska.

Senate committee hears Schmidt contest case in Montana

The senate elections committee hears the Schmidt contest over Fred Schmidt's Senate seat from Weston county. Key dispute: whether homesteaders who filed over a year before the election but moved onto land within nine months could vote, a ruling once supported by the attorney general and followed by election officials, but now challenged by Mr. Jeffries through Attorney Beach of Newcantle. The hearing involves several partisan actors and questions about required registration affidavits, with a second line of inquiry on alleged influence by neutral Republican candidates.

Industrial Democracy to Prevent Social Unrest Says Guggenheim

New York January 22. George W. Perkins and Daniel Guggenheim testified before the federal commission on industrial relations. Guggenheim urged heavy taxation of large fortunes, government job programs for the unemployed, aging worker care, and industrial democracy where workers share no profits. He noted his firms monitor labor conditions and advocate improving welfare and efficiency. Berwind remained cautious, while other witnesses include Samuel Gomper and Henry Ford.
